Using the Move to iOS App
The most straightforward method is Apple's own "Move to iOS" app, available on the Google Play Store. This app securely transfers your data from your Android device to your new iPhone. Here’s how to use it: — Hard White Animal Fat: Uses, Benefits, And More
- Download and Install: On your Android phone, download the "Move to iOS" app from the Google Play Store.
- Start the Setup Process on Your iPhone: Turn on your new iPhone and follow the on-screen instructions until you reach the "Apps & Data" screen.
- Select Move Data from Android: On the "Apps & Data" screen, choose "Move Data from Android."
- Open Move to iOS on Android: Launch the "Move to iOS" app on your Android phone and tap "Continue."
- Accept Terms and Conditions: Read and agree to the terms and conditions.
- Find Your Code: On your iPhone, tap "Continue" on the "Move from Android" screen. A ten-digit code will appear.
- Enter the Code: Enter this code into the "Move to iOS" app on your Android phone.
- Select Data to Transfer: Choose the data you want to transfer, such as contacts, message history, photos, videos, web bookmarks, mail accounts, and calendars. Tap "Next."
- Wait for the Transfer: Keep both devices connected and don't use them until the transfer is complete. The progress bar on your iPhone will indicate when the process is finished.
- Complete Setup: Once the transfer is done, tap "Done" on your Android phone. On your iPhone, tap "Continue" and follow the on-screen steps to finish the setup process.
What Data Can Be Transferred?
The "Move to iOS" app supports transferring various types of data, including:
- Contacts
- Message history
- Photos and videos
- Web bookmarks
- Mail accounts
- Calendars
Alternative Methods for Transferring Data
If you prefer not to use the "Move to iOS" app, or if you have data that the app doesn't support, here are a few alternative methods:
Google Account
Your contacts, calendar events, and emails are likely synced with your Google account. Simply sign in to your Google account on your iPhone to sync this data.
Third-Party Apps
Several third-party apps can help transfer specific types of data. For example, you can use cloud storage services like Google Drive, Dropbox, or OneDrive to transfer files manually.
Computer Transfer

Tips for a Smooth Transition
- Charge Both Devices: Ensure both your Android and iPhone are fully charged before starting the transfer process.
- Stable Wi-Fi Connection: A stable Wi-Fi connection is crucial for a smooth and fast transfer.
- Disable Wi-Fi Assist: On your iPhone, go to Settings > Cellular and disable Wi-Fi Assist to prevent interruptions during the transfer.
- Enough Storage: Ensure your iPhone has enough storage space for all the data you're transferring.
